
Kurzy a certifikace Dev & Test
React
React.js fundamentals
9.800 CZK
Cena (bez DPH)
Days1
27. 1. 2021
virtual
CZ
10. 3. 2021
virtual
CZ
Kurz React.js je určen vývojářům, kteří se chtějí naučit vytvářet moderní webové aplikace za použití frameworku React.js. V rámci kurzu se naučí navrhovat React.js komponenty, pochopí principy frameworku a seznámí s moderním javascriptovým ekosystémem. Kurz je veden zejména formou praktických cvičení, každou věc si tedy účastníci vyzkouší okamžitě na vlastní kůži, což usnadňuje zapamatování a pochopení informací. Po skončení kurzu budou účastníci schopni samostatně tvořit javascriptové single page aplikace ve frameworku React.js.
Cílová skupina
- vývojářské týmy, které chtějí začít tvořit aplikace ve frameworku React.js
- vývojáři, kteří se chtějí naučit framework React.js pro svou práci
Cíle kurzu
- navrhovat frontendové aplikace za použití React.js
- porozumět principům frameworku React.js
- vytvářet formuláře s uživatelsky přívětivou validací
- použití AJAXu v React.js aplikaci
- routing
- správné rozdělení aplikace do nezávislých komponent
- organizace CSS stylů v aplikaci
- psaní testovatelného kódu a testování React.js aplikací
Osnova
Úvod
- SPA aplikace
- Javascript ve verzi ES2018
- používání node.js a npm
- vytvoření základu aplikace pomocí create-react-app
React.js
- komponenty
- state vs. props
- Ajax v React.js
Organizace aplikace
- doporučená adresářová struktura
- routování
- rozdělení komponent na hloupé a chytré
- organizace CSS stylů
Ekosystém
- ES2018
Předpoklady účastníka
Znalost programovacího jazyku Javascript a HTML, zkušenosti s programováním.
Technické požadavky
- bude potřeba programátorský editor například Visual Studio Code,
- dále konzolové nástroje node.js, npm a yarn